MAINTENANCE

WARNING: Always unplug the treadmill before cleaning or maintance.
General cleaning will greatly prolong the treadmill.
!
Keep treadmill clean by dusting regularly. Be sure to clean the
exposed part of the deck on either side of the walking belt and also the
side rails. Keep the running shoes clean to avoid foreign material
underneath the walking belt
!
WARNING: Always unplug the treadmill before removing motor cover.
Make sure to removing the motor cover and clean the motor one time
per year.
Running belt and deck lubrication oil
This treadmill is equipped with a pre-lubricated, low maintenance deck system. The belt/ deck
friction may play a major role in the function and life of your treadmill, thus requiring periodic
lubrication. We recommend a periodic inspection of the deck. You need contact with our service
center if you find the damage of the deck.
We recommend lubrication of the deck according to the following timetable:
Ø
Light user (less than 3 hours/ week) - Annually
Ø
Medium user (3-5 hours/ week) - Every six months
Ø
Heavy user (more than 5 hours/ week) - every three months
NOTE:
Only use "Silicone Oil" lubricants for this equipment. In addition, do not add any other
oil ingredient; otherwise, the treadmill will be damaged. Do not over-lubricate the walking board.
Excess lubricant should be wiped off with a clean towel. We recommend that you buy the
lubrication from our distributor or directly from us.
